Transaction 0bc96ebb35a703008ae809202b4ef268411243f7c3fdbf1e6e3d8a6902635328
1 Input
1 Output
-
0bc96ebb35a703008ae809202b4ef268411243f7c3fdbf1e6e3d8a6902635328:0
- value
- 2063137
- script pubkey
- OP_0 OP_PUSHBYTES_20 87e63d1de6b8c8f19dc6a0a6223b9f3410d5f574
- address
- bc1qslnr680xhry0r8wx5znzywulxsgdtat5twme04